Abstract

The utility model relates to implement the positioning of workpiece and observation field, specially a kind of online laser mark printing device of high temperature billet steel with laser beam.A kind of online laser mark printing device of high temperature billet steel, including pedestal (1) and transmission device (2), it is characterized in that: further including intelligent robot (4), controller (41) and two sets of servo mechanisms (42) are equipped in intelligent robot (4), controller (41) is separately connected each set servo mechanism (42) by signal wire, and two sets of servo mechanisms (42) are separately connected spray equipment (5) and laser emitter (6).The utility model is compact structure and easy to use, and mark is clear, and label adhesive force is strong.

Description

The online laser mark printing device of high temperature billet steel
Technical field
The utility model relates to implement the positioning of workpiece and observation field with laser beam, specially a kind of high temperature billet steel is online Laser mark printing device.
Background technique
The management and tracking that the finished product of steel rolling process needs to mark the information such as production heat (batch) number, steel grade, time to carry out material, It is cooling uniform that billet needs continuous turn-over to guarantee in cooling procedure, and label is normally at the end face of steel billet, existing high temperature The font that spray printing, electric spark mark is larger to be marked on end face, therefore mesh use will be after steel billet be cooled to room temperature by people Work is labelled, and working environment is poor, and easily generation safety accident, label is easy to fall off, and fails to be marked in source and is easy to obscure Error.In addition, high temperature red heat steel billet temperature is up to 1000 DEG C or so, billet surface is in Chinese red, for 10.6 μm of CO of wavelength2 Laser has very strong reflex, CO2Laser, which is difficult to be formed in hot billet surface, to be marked.
Utility model content
In order to overcome the drawbacks of the prior art, provide it is a kind of it is compact-sized, easy to use, mark is clear, label adhesive force Strong mark equipment, the utility model discloses a kind of online laser mark printing devices of high temperature billet steel.
The utility model reaches goal of the invention by following technical solution:
A kind of online laser mark printing device of high temperature billet steel, including pedestal and transmission device, transmission device are fixed on the base, Steel billet is set on transmission device, it is characterized in that: further include intelligent robot,
Controller and two sets of servo mechanisms are equipped in intelligent robot, controller is separately connected each set servo by signal wire Mechanism, two sets of servo mechanisms are separately connected spray equipment and laser emitter.
The online laser mark printing device of the high temperature billet steel, it is characterized in that: fire resistant water-based coating, face built in spray equipment Color is white, and particle outer diameter is not more than 2mm, and pH value is 2~2.2;
The laser parameter of laser transmitter projects is as follows: output power is not less than 25w, wavelength 1064nm, Laser emission Device is not less than 20hz to the scan frequency of steel billet, and focal length is 208mm ± 2mm;
Water cooling heat shield is designed with outside intelligent robot, spray equipment and laser emitter;
Controller selects any one in programmable controller, single-chip microcontroller and microcomputer.
The application method of the online laser mark printing device of the high temperature billet steel, it is characterized in that: successively implementing as follows:
1. spraying: the steel billet of red heat is transported to mark station by transmission device, and intelligent robot receives steel billet in place After signal, controller controls intelligent robot and stretches out from holding fix, and controls spray equipment to steel billet end by servo mechanism Face sprays fire resistant water-based coating to form circular mark in steel billet end face;
2. mark: intelligent robot is by the distance of laser emitter detecting distance steel billet end face, and controller is according to measuring Distance signal running fix, make laser emitter be aligned focus, subsequent laser emitter is to steel billet end face laser in steel billet Steel billet information is stamped in the circular mark region formed on end face by fire resistant water-based coating, steel billet information is by higher level's information management System determines;
3. return: intelligent robot returns to waiting for position.
1000 DEG C of high temperature billet steel can be directly marked in the utility model, the information marked by the utility model, There is good heat vibration performance, be heated to 1000 DEG C repeatedly, mark still high-visible after cooling, identification is reliable.
The utility model realizes full-automatic Unmanned operation using the operation of intelligent robot air exercise target, positioning, solves High temperature billet steel just can directly carry out on-line marking to red heat steel billet after milling train in wire tag, can in red heat steel billet subscript The various informations such as numeration word, bar code, two dimensional code and icon can quickly and easily read each letter using identifier Breath solves the problems, such as that the material tracking of square billet and final-period management are difficult in steel rolling, provide for material tracking and unmanned management Basic information.
The utility model has the following beneficial effects:
1. marking for 1000 DEG C of red bases of high temperature can be realized;
2. can reference numerals, bar code, two dimensional code and icon etc., using identifier, can fast, easily read it is every One information;
3. the mark period (i.e. spraying+laser beam marking time) meets existing cold bed moving period, production section is not influenced It plays;
4. 65 DEG C of operating ambient temperature can be born;100 DEG C of high temperature can be born in short-term;
5. compact-sized, engaged position is small, can easily be arranged on existing production line.

Specific embodiment
The utility model is further illustrated below by way of specific embodiment.
Embodiment 1
A kind of online laser mark printing device of high temperature billet steel, including pedestal 1, transmission device 2, intelligent robot 4, spray equipment 5 and laser emitter 6, as shown in FIG. 1 to 3, specific structure is:
Transmission device 2 is fixed on pedestal 1, and steel billet 3 is set on transmission device 2;
Controller 41 is equipped in intelligent robot 4 and two sets of servo mechanisms 42, controller 41 are separately connected by signal wire Each set servo mechanism 42, two sets of servo mechanisms 42 are separately connected spray equipment 5 and laser emitter 6.
In the present embodiment: fire resistant water-based coating built in spray equipment 5, color are white, and particle outer diameter is not more than 2mm, PH value is 2~2.2;
The laser parameter that laser emitter 6 emits is as follows: output power is not less than 25w, wavelength 1064nm, Laser emission Device 6 is not less than 20hz to the scan frequency of steel billet 3, and focal length is 208mm ± 2mm;The optical maser wavelength that the present embodiment uses is much short In CO2The wavelength of laser is not easy smoothly realize the surface marking in steel billet 3 by the surface reflection of high temperature red heat steel billet 3;
Water cooling heat shield is designed with outside intelligent robot 4, spray equipment 5 and laser emitter 6;
Controller 41 can select programmable controller, single-chip microcontroller or microcomputer.
The present embodiment in use, successively implement as follows:
1. spraying: the steel billet 3 of red heat is transported to mark station by transmission device 2, and intelligent robot 4 receives steel billet 3 In place after signal, controller 41 controls intelligent robot 4 and stretches out from holding fix, and controls spray equipment by servo mechanism 42 5 spray fire resistant water-based coating to 3 end face of steel billet to form circular mark in 3 end face of steel billet;
2. mark: intelligent robot 4 is by the distance of 6 detecting distance steel billet of laser emitter, 3 end face, controller 41 According to the distance signal running fix measured, laser emitter 6 is made to be directed at focus, subsequent laser emitter 6 is to 3 end face laser of steel billet To stamp 3 information of steel billet in the circular mark region that is formed on 3 end face of steel billet by fire resistant water-based coating, 3 information of steel billet by Higher level's information management system determines;
3. return: intelligent robot 4 returns to waiting for position.
